WI vs BAN 1st Test: Kemar Roach puts West Indies on verge of victory against battling Bangladesh

Kemar Roach's enduring quality and consistency put the West Indies within 35 runs of victory over Bangladesh going into the fourth day of the first Test. His five for 53 from 24.5 overs in the Bangladesh second innings total of 245 looked, briefly, as if it would be overshadowed though by a stunning West Indies collapse in pursuit of a modest target of 84 as the hosts slipped to nine for three late on the third day Saturday. Those three wickets by seamer Khaled Ahmed - he removed captain Kraigg Brathwaite, Raymon Reifer and Nkrumah Bonner in quick succession - lit a fire under the Bangladeshis.

England pacer Katherine Brunt announces retirement from Test cricket

Katherine Brunt on Saturday announced her retirement from Test cricket, calling time on a career that spanned 17 years. The 36-year-old seamer will continue to play in the shorter formats of the game. Brunt made her Test debut in 2004, and was part of an influential moment for English cricket in just her third Test match - bagging nine wickets across the match and smashing 52 to help her team to retain the Women's Ashes after 42 years. Brunt claimed it was a 'smart' decision to retire from the game in order to prolong her white-ball career.

"He Did Not Expect I Could...": Rishabh Pant On Taking On Nathan Lyon In Brisbane Test

No cricket fan can forget the 2020-21 Border-Gavaskar Trophy as the series saw an injury-hit Team India punching above their weight to stun hosts Australia. Going into the series decider at Gabba, the proceedings were level at 1-1 and there was everything to play for at the Gabba, which was seen as a fortress for the Aussies. However, Rishabh Pant produced a quality fourth-innings knock to help India chase down 328 with three wickets in hand on the final day of the Test. As a result of this knock, India won the series 2-1 against all odds.

1st Test, Day 2: Bangladesh stare at defeat inside three days against West Indies

West Indies were eventually dismissed in their first innings for 265 after tea, having started the morning at 95 for two. Captain Kraigg Brathwaite anchored his side's effort with a typically painstaking 400-minute knock of 94, supported by 63 from Jermaine Blackwood, the vice-captain taking a page from his leader's operational manual as the contribution was the slowest of his 16 Test half-centuries.
